Abstract (EN): Pressurization and blowdown of adsorption beds with a binary mixture of inert and adsorbable gas are studied. For pressurization, the stoichiometric penetration distance for the feed is predicted using a simplified analysis. An equilibrium model is then developed involving material and momentum balance equations to describe the bed dynamics. The pressure drop is given by Ergun's or Darcy's equations, and adsorption equilibrium is described by linear or Langmuir isotherms. The effects of pressure drop equation, isotherm shape, adsorbent capacity, pressure ratio and feed composition on penetration distance, pressurization time and pressurization amount are assessed. For blowdown, the equilibrium model is used to evaluate the bed dynamics. Also, plateau concentrations for blowdown, estimated using a simplified analysis, are compared with predictions of the equilibrium model.
